Plymouth Street, Swindon house prices

Homes in Plymouth Street, Swindon have a median sold price of £122,875 — every figure here comes straight from HM Land Registry. Over the past decade prices are +98% in cash — but +43% once inflation is stripped out.

Plymouth Street, Swindon house prices — your questions

What is the average house price in Plymouth Street, Swindon?

Half of homes sold in Plymouth Street, Swindon went for more than £122,875 and half for less, across 92 sales.

What is the price range of homes sold in Plymouth Street, Swindon?

Recorded sales in Plymouth Street, Swindon range from £41,500 to £240,000. The range includes flats and large detached homes alike.

Have house prices in Plymouth Street, Swindon risen?

Over the past decade prices in Plymouth Street, Swindon are +98% in cash terms but +43% once adjusted for inflation using ONS CPIH — the gap between the two is the real story.

How much is a house per square metre in Plymouth Street, Swindon?

In Plymouth Street, Swindon the median price is £1,558 per square metre, from 64 sales matched to an EPC floor-area record.

How up to date is this data?

HM Land Registry publishes Price Paid Data monthly. The most recent sale recorded in Plymouth Street, Swindon was 1 July 2025.
